Recognizing the Value of Proper Bed Elevation
Proper bed height is vital for both client convenience and caretaker safety and security. Goal for a height that enables very easy access for both you and the person when you set up a healthcare facility bed. If the bed's too low, flexing down can stress your back, while a bed that's expensive can make it tough for clients to obtain in and out safely.Adjust the bed to an elevation that's level with the individual's knees when they're remaining on the edge. This setting aids them transfer in and out of bed with very little initiative. In addition, proper elevation can avoid drops and advertise freedom, encouraging clients to relocate with confidence.

Stress Alleviation Strategies
Efficient stress alleviation is essential for people investing lengthy periods in a medical facility bed, and making use of cushions and cushions can make a considerable difference. Begin by putting paddings under bony locations like the heels, joints, and sacrum to reduce stress. You can additionally use a specialized pressure-relief pillow for the seat to disperse weight equally. In addition, consider using pillows to boost the head or legs, which can boost convenience and advertise blood circulation. Bear in mind to on a regular basis rearrange the individual to avoid long term stress on any type of certain area. Watch on skin integrity, and urge the person to move settings when possible. These straightforward changes can considerably improve comfort and lower the danger of pressure sores.
Ensuring Safety And Security With Bed Bed Rails and Locking Mechanisms
One crucial element of establishing a medical facility bed is guaranteeing safety and security with bed rails and locking devices. Begin by readjusting the bed rails to the proper height, so they supply sufficient assistance without restricting motion. Make sure they're securely involved to prevent unintended falls. Check the rails by gently pushing down; they need to remain solid and stable.Next, pay very close attention to the locking systems. Validate that the bed's wheels are locked when the client remains in placement, avoiding any kind of undesirable movement. Consistently check these locks for deterioration, as malfunctioning locks can present substantial risks.Finally, educate the client regarding making use of bed rails. Clarify their objective and motivate them to ask for aid when required. By prioritizing safety and security, you can assist produce a protected setting that enhances client convenience and reduces the danger of injury.
